ICYMI: To mark RuralHealthDay, SecAzar hosted a bipartisan conversation with Members of Congress on how to address the challenges facing Americans living in rural settings.
They discussed the work already being done by the Department to address rural health challenges, including revisions to the Medicare Wage Index, reduction of regulatory burdens, addressing maternal mortality and morbidity and the opioid crisis, and lowering the cost of prescription drugs.
Secretary Azar mentioned several particular areas where HHS believes it can improve health for rural Americans, including a focus on preventing disease, creating sustainable models for financing, using technology and innovation to improve patient access, and building the next generation of rural health providers.
They also discussed the importance of continued congressional engagement on this topic and the importance of lowering prescription drug costs. Secretary Azar expressed his thanks to the Members for their leadership in improving health outcomes for Americans in rural settings.
